Subscribe to our channel! Cleanup efforts continued in the town of Mihe on Sunday, after Henan Province had been hit by a deadly flood that killed at least 63 people. Volunteers and emergency workers were seen hauling off debris and damaged belongings, as well as using cranes to remove the rubble. “It was flooding for two days and two nights. When the three major floods came, the town leaders took us to patrol the river for safety reasons because we are in a mountain torrent zone, where outbreak can easily happen. Then the next morning the communication was cut off, the roads were interrupted, the national highways were all smashed, and all the houses, property, and factory buildings were destroyed,“ said Mihe village committee member Zhao Liting.
